GMA Network's reality singing competition "PROTEGE" premieres September 4

iGMA:

After scouring the entire archipelago for potential aspirants, GMA Network's all-original singing talent search, PROTÉGÉ: The Battle for the Big Break, makes its grand and highly-anticipated premiere on Philippine Television on September 4.

Protégé invades Filipino homes with a new breed of performers with unique voices and raw talents who will soon become the contry's next batch of singing sensations.

This first-of-its-kind singing competition showcasing 10 of the industry's most adored legends as mentors, will be hosted by a fresh combination of Kapuso stars including singer-songwriter Ogie Alcasid as Journey Host, multi-awarded drama actor Dingdong Dantes as Gala Presentor and versatile actress Jennylyn Mercado as Reality Host. Ogie delivers the backstage drama and the emotional highs and lows in teh life of every aspirant while Dingdong hosts the live Sunday gala night presentations and Jennylyn takes over the 10-minute Mondays - Saturdays updates on the aspirants' quest for musical stardom.

The 10 highly-respected mentors who were sent out to different parts of the country to find the three protégés include The King of Soul JANNO GIBBS for Iloilo, The Queen of Soul JAYA for Davao, The Prince of R&B JAY-R for Cabanatuan, The Ultimate Singing Champion RACHELLE ANN GO for Cebu, The Wordsmith of Rap GLOC-9 for Manila, The Acoustic Sensation AIZA SEGUERRA for Cagayan de Oro, The Sentimental Songstress MS. IMELDA PAPIN for Naga, The Country's Sweetest Voice MS. CLAIRE DELA FUENTE for Batangas, The Platinum-Selling Vocalist JOEY GENEROSO of SIDE A for Dagupan, and Mr. Hitmaker REY VALERA for Pampanga.

These award-winning music personalities will not only share their professional guidance to their protégés in every rehearsal, vocal workshop and studio recording but also invest on their looks, and over-all packaging and showmanship in hopes of winning over the judges' and the viewers' votes.

The three formidable and high-profile Protégé Judges are well-renowned composer/musical director/writer LOUIE OCAMPO, well-respected talent manager/director BERT DE LEON and entertainment guru, JOEY DE LEON.

More and more Filipino music artists are auditioning for Protege: The Battle of the Big Break

More and more Filipino music artists are auditioning for the newest singing superstar search on Philippine TV, Protégé: The Battle for the Big Break! Last weekend, Cabanatuan, Nueva Ecija and San Fernando, Pampanga became the sites of the massive gatherings of Pinoy talents.

Despite the typhoon, hopefuls from different provinces lined up at the Protégé call-out that happened inside Nueva Ecija Pacific Mall. Applicants braved the storm and came all the way from Nueva Vizcaya, Quirino, Bataan, Tarlac, Pangasinan, Quezon, Aparri, Cagayan and Isabela just to make it to the auditions and perform in front of Mentor Jay-R.

A female vocal quartet composed of siblings from Isabela shook up JayR with their acapella and beat-box rendition of Lady Gaga's Telephone.

Among the highlights was when the RnB prince went to the house of a prospective protégé in Cabanatuan to ask for his father's approval on the audition. To Jay-R's surprise, the young man he was looking for was not home that day. According to his father who had a stroke, his son went to Baguio for a personal reason. Later that day, Jay-R found out that the man he was supposed to invite personally was already in NE Pacific Mall for the Protégé search. The young mentor witnessed a dramatic moment as the old man gave his approval. Other heartwarming and heart-wrenching events unfolded in Cabanatuan as JayR searched for his three potential protégés.

SM City in San Fernando, Pampanga was the next stop for the Protégé Call-out, where the number of applicants was higher by an astounding 300% than in Nueva Ecija. Mentor Rey Valera was challenged with the pool of talents he found in the city. Rap groups, rock bands, duos, boy and girl bands, and other musicians stormed the venue.

Pampangeños and music artists from Bataan, Bulacan, Metro Manila, Tarlac and Zambales fought for the three Protégé spots allotted for Rey Valera. The overwhelming showcase of talents in the city stirred up the audition results, and for the first time in this "hunt" stage, a shocking decision from a mentor was made.

Four more cities are about to become the hot spots for Filipino musical ingenuity: Davao (SM City Davao) on August 5 with Jaya, Dagupan (CSI Mall) on August 7 wth Joey Generoso of Side A Band, Cagayan de Oro (SM CDO) on August 10 with Aiza Seguerra and Manila (SM MOA Music Hall) on August 12 with Gloc9. --Text and photo courtesy of GMA Network
